Synonym selection checklist

  • Match the part of speech before comparing meanings.
  • Check whether the synonym changes intensity, formality, or emotional tone.
  • Read the replacement inside the full sentence, not just beside "responsive".
  • Prefer the clearest word over the most unusual word when writing for speed or comprehension.

When not to replace "responsive"

Keep "responsive" when the sentence already sounds natural, when a synonym would add unintended emphasis, or when readers need the most familiar wording. A synonym should clarify or sharpen the message, not simply make the sentence look more varied.

If two options seem close, choose the one that best matches the audience and purpose of the sentence.
